Rebecca M.

Yelp
Among the many reasons why I love Williams-Sonoma are its organized layout, desirable inventory, friendly and knowledgeable service, samples!, quality products, frequent sales and military discount. Who could ask for more!? If you're looking for quality food items (from the chili starter base to cocktail mixers to gourmet vinegar to dark chocolate pepperoni bark) this is your place! Quality tools and appliances that make cooking easier and shave time off meal prep--look no further. And of course (my favorite!), beautiful and functional tableware to bring color and style to the dishes you serve family and friends when you enjoy a meal together. W-S has my number and knows how to reel me in. Just last week I bought the entire table setting featured in the store's entrance. Although not 100% authentic to the Chinese culture, their Lunar New Year table settings are a beautiful mix of zodiac signs and traditional cloisonné of flowers, koi, dragons, and phoenixes!! The set brings such joy to my tabletop! On the other hand, this is not a discount store. Because all the lovely things you will find at W-S can put quite the dent in your wallet, I recommend signing up for the emails (20% off at least once a month) and also the Key Rewards system that gives you rewards dollars back to spend on your next purchase. W-S support our service men and women and offer 15% off any retail purchase to any military or dependent with ID. The Fair Oaks location has some of the nicest and most helpful employees I've ever dealt with and it seems to be a store policy to be patient and kind when dealing with their customers. You'll be sure to get exactly what you wanted and know the warranty, complementing pieces, discounts, and delivery options for anything you purchase here in this location.

Shane G.

Yelp
STOP BY, CHANCES ARE YOU'LL BE A RETURN CUSTOMER, I SURE AM!!! STAFF: Very approachable. On several occasions they have not only helped me narrow down my search but they've also shown me proper techniques and use of the items I was looking to purchase. STOCK: This particular site has a wide variety of items anything you'd need or want in the kitchen. Considering this store focuses on cookware you'd be hard-pressed to not find what you're looking for. I have been very impressed with the variety and quality of the items offered. Not only do they have a good selection you can actually be hands-on and get a "real feel" for the items rather than going home only to find out what you bought doesn't work for you. If for some reason they don't have what you're looking for keep in mind online ordering is always an option. They have pretty much anything you can want or think of. PRICING: QUALITY PRODUCTS. Many of the items, such as utensils, are comparable, and in some cases cheaper, to those you'd find at places like Target or Walmart however, in my opinion the items here are a much higher quality and will last you longer. Although some of the cookware can prove to be a pricey investment I don't doubt they'd last a lifetime. Personally I'd rather pay more in the beginning than have to replace cookware over-and-over which ultimately leads to you spending more in the long run. If you're anything like me budgeting is very important which is why I'll purchase items here and there (it's been worth it and I haven't had a single complaint with any of my purchases). Keep in mind that they often have sales which tend to be a significant saving. Military discounts are also given. OTHER: Special services are offered FREE; for instance they will come to your home and help you set up your kitchen so that you get the best and most efficient use of your kitchen, not only that but they will make recommendations they believe would further improve your overall cooking experience. They also on-site cooking classes are offered FREE. These classes range anywhere from basic skills to making "special" dishes and recipes. I recommend contacting them to get schedules. I haven't been to any classes yet however I've learned many techniques by simply talking to the associates before buying items. Something to keep in mind is if you decide to shop at a Williams-Sonoma Outlet you aren't able to exchange/return it's to the store as they are two seperate entities.
